Angry 2006 Toyota 4 runner rear parking brakes

Im kinda new to this forum so if i'm incorrectly posting the wrong place forgive me. I need some sure fired tips on how to get the horse shoe like pin in the parking brake shoe and around the parking brake lever on the back side of shoe. I put it through the backing plate but I can't get it to go around brake lever and line up with the hole in the brake shoe to put the retainer cup and spring on.( Help) is there a trick someone can give me to get this shoe on. I've worked on the da-- thing for hours. needle nose pliers and every trick I know with no luck. that one pin is a horseshoe shape and its giving me hell. also the da-- axle hub is so big it covers the both shoes. There is such a small area to work. This is getting on my last nerve.

See if this youtube video (installing 06 4 runner parking brake youtube) at the link below will help you. If you have not changed many shoes you will learn the springs can be challenging. There are some dedicated tools that are usually handy on standard shoe’s springs (that might be available for the smaller area). I find needle nose vise grips to be handy if hand strength is an issue. Last I try to watch a Local Friendly Mechanic for tips or ask and they might show you the tricks they have learned.
